About the Role & Team Disney’s Direct-to-Consumer team oversees the Hulu and Disney+ streaming businesses within Disney Entertainment, helping bring The Walt Disney Company’s best-in-class storytelling to fans and families everywhere. The Disney+ Global Content Programming and Subscriber Engagement team leads content planning, scheduling, on-service merchandising, slate management, and programming insights that contribute to a cohesive, strategic content approach for the service.

The Content Planning Associate will provide essential support to the global Disney+ Content Planning & Scheduling team within Disney+ Programming. This role will support initiatives related to the Disney catalog and acquired content, including database maintenance and auditing, localization strategy, global release strategy, and day-to-day change management throughout the lifecycle of a title. The ideal candidate has exceptional attention to detail, strong written and verbal communication skills, and a collaborative and diplomatic working style. This role will also help establish processes and enhance support tools and will report to the Manager, Content Planning.

What You Will Do The Content Planning Associate will support global content planning and scheduling efforts for Disney+ by maintaining accurate title information, coordinating global premiere dates, communicating changes to key stakeholders, and supporting content throughout its lifecycle.

Responsibilities • Manage the tracking and reporting of Disney+ global premiere dates for catalog and acquired content in partnership with global and local planning teams. • Communicate day-to-day changes and schedule updates to key stakeholders. • Represent Disney+ Content Planning in meetings and written communications with professionalism and diplomacy. • Maintain and assist with the development of databases, reports, and documents for leadership and key stakeholders throughout the lifecycle of a title. • Support localization and global release strategies for Disney+ content. • Help establish processes and enhance tools that support content planning and scheduling. • Provide support for ad hoc projects and requests.

Required Qualifications & Skills • 2+ years of experience in content planning, content curation, content strategy, or a related area. • Excellent written and verbal communication skills. • Ability to multitask, prioritize, and independently manage multiple assignments accurately and efficiently. • 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ment while demonstrating strong organizational skills, precise attention to detail, and consistent follow-through. • Self-starter with a solution-oriented approach. • Demonstrated professionalism, diplomacy, and tact, with the ability to maintain the highest level of confidentiality. • Ability to maintain a positive and professional demeanor under pressure. • Sound judgment and instincts when navigating complex situations and environments. • Strong interpersonal and relationship-building skills, with the ability to establish trust and confidence. • Adaptable and comfortable navigating evolving processes, structures, tools, and priorities. • Proficiency in Microsoft applications, including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Teams. • Proficiency in Google applications, including Slides, Docs, and Sheets. • Passion for The Walt Disney Company’s segments, brands, and franchises.

Preferred Qualifications • Experience in subscription video-on-demand (SVOD) or linear television. • Proficiency in Airtable is a plus. • Previous SVOD experience.

Required Education • Bachelor’s degree.

Additional Information • This role sits in the Glendale office 4 days a week from Monday through Thursday with flexibility to work from home on Fridays

The hiring range for this position in Glendale is $72,000.00 to $96,500.00 per year. The base pay actually offered will take into account internal equity and also may vary depending on the candidate’s geographic region, job-related knowledge, skills, and experience among other factors. A bonus and/or long-term incentive units may be provided as part of the compensation package, in addition to the full range of medical, financial, and/or other benefits, dependent on the level and position offered.
